- stc Group has joined Bridge Alliance’s API Exchange (BAEx) as the first operator from the MENA region, expanding collaboration in IoT and telco APIs.
- The partnership aims to drive innovation and digital transformation in the MENA region and beyond.
What happened: stc Group strengthens Bridge Alliance partnership, becoming first MENA operator to commit to BAEx
On February 12, 2025, at the LEAP global technology conference in Riyadh, Saudi Arabia, stc Group and Bridge Alliance announced an agreement to further strengthen their collaboration. As part of the partnership, stc Group, including its operating companies in Bahrain, Kuwait, and Saudi Arabia, will become the first MENA operator to join Bridge Alliance’s API Exchange (BAEx).
This partnership will enable stc Group to access a unified platform for telco APIs, significantly reducing complexity and streamlining commercial processes for stc and its enterprise customers. By simplifying the integration of telco APIs, BAEx supports innovation and helps create new business opportunities and revenue streams for stc in various markets.
In addition to telco APIs, stc Group and Bridge Alliance will continue their cooperation in the Internet of Things (IoT) space, including exploring connected car projects in the Middle East and developing smart city infrastructure.

Why it’s important
The integration of stc Group into the Bridge Alliance API Exchange marks a significant milestone for the MENA region, enhancing access to telco APIs and driving the region’s digital transformation. By joining BAEx, stc will benefit from a simplified, unified integration framework and a single contract for easier access to APIs, accelerating the development of new services and solutions.
The collaboration is set to unlock new potential in IoT and connected technologies, contributing to innovations like smart cars and smart cities in the region, while boosting stc Group’s position as a leader in the digital space.
